“Allure is something that does exist. "Allure holds you...whether it's a gaze or a glance in the street or a face in a crowd...it pervades...you are captured by it.” Diana Vreeland, Fashion journalist
Two vintage photographs by Richard Avedon from the 1950s were the initial inspiration for the Susanne von Meiss Collection. For 25 years now, the Swiss journalist, publicist and entrepreneur has been collecting photography with the special focus on “allure”. The Susanne von Meiss Collection representatively covers all genres and styles in the history of photography ― from the 1920s through to the present.
It includes works by internationally renowned photographers, however for the main part it does not give preference to the iconic photographs but rather to unknown classics. The personal selection ranges from Diane Arbus, Richard Avedon, Rene Burri and Henri Cartier-Bresson through Horst P. Horst, Irving Penn, Paolo Roversi and August Sander to contemporary artists such as Tracey Emin, Nan Goldin, Daido Moriyama, Richard Prince and Juergen Teller. The collection will be presented to the public for the first time at C/O Berlin.

Felix Hoffmann is an art historian and art theorist, and is currently Chief Curator at C/O Berlin which is an institution focused on contemporary photography and New Media in Berlin.
Birgit Filzmaier is a private photography dealer based in Zurich, Switzerland, specializing in classic photographs of the 19th and 20th century with a special emphasis on advising private clients in forming their collections.“Allure is something that does exist.
